Miami home sales rise on low prices 

Jul 29, 2011By

Home sales in the greater Miami area grew for the seventh consecutive month in June as low prices fueled demand taking the place of last year’s federal homebuyer tax credit. The Miami area, which includes the counties of Miami-Dade, Palm Beach and Broward, recorded 9,857 home sales in June, up 1.4% from May and 6% from last year, real estate data firm DataQuick said Friday. Home sales rose as prices slipped, with the median sales price falling 10% from June of last year.
